I'm super excited to launch my new product, Tweetlet. 🚀
Tweetlet is a free tool that lets you create beautiful images from tweets, text, and any other images with nice backgrounds in a snap.
The idea behind this was to reuse the text content that I post on Twitter for other social media and also present the info in an attractive way without spending much time on it.
You can create nice images from text, code, tweets, and any other images using Tweetlet.
The design of Tweetlet is inspired by the poet so website.
Tweetlet's text mode supports markdown text which means you can create rich text so easily and create images out of it including the image and code embeds.
